Preparation and Cooking Time

You can whip up a delicious Masala Baked Fish meal in just over an hour. Here’s the time breakdown:

  • Preparation Time: 20 minutes
  • Cooking Time: 30-35 minutes
  • Marinating Time: 15-30 minutes (optional but recommended)

Ingredients

  • 2-4 pieces of fish fillets (such as cod, tilapia, or salmon)
  • 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
  • 1 tablespoon ginger-garlic paste
  • 1 teaspoon turmeric powder
  • 1 teaspoon red ch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on garam masala
  • 1 teaspoon cumin powder
  • 1 teaspoon coriander powder
  • Salt, to taste
  • Juice of 1 lemon
  • Fresh cilantro, chopped (for garnish)

Step-by-Step Instructions

Follow these simple steps to create your Masala Baked Fish:

  1. Preheat the Oven: Set your oven to 375°F (190°C) to prepare for baking.
  2. Prepare the Marinade: In a bowl, mix the ginger-garlic paste, turmeric powder, red chili powder, garam masala, cumin powder, coriander powder, salt, lemon juice, and vegetable oil until well combined.
  3. Marinate the Fish: Rub the marinade all over the fish fillets. Let them marinate for at least 15 minutes, or longer for more flavor.
  4. Prepare the Baking Dish: Lightly grease a baking dish with oil to prevent sticking.
  5. Arrange the Fish: Place the marinated fish fillets in the baking dish in a single layer.
  6. Bake the Fish: Cook in the preheated oven for 30-35 minutes or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.
  7. Garnish: Remove from the oven and sprinkle with fresh cilantro for added flavor and color.
  8. Serve Hot: Allow the fish to sit for a few minutes before serving.

Additional Tips

  • Use Fresh Fish: Whenever possible, opt for fresh fish over frozen for a taste that truly shines.
  • Adjust Spice Levels: If you prefer milder flavors, reduce the amount of red chili powder in the marinade.
  • Experiment with Herbs: Adding fresh herbs, like mint or parsley, can offer a unique flavor twist that complements the spices.
  • Increase the Lemon Juice: For a zesty flair, add more lemon juice to the marinade before applying it to the fish.
  • Customize Cooking Time: Depending on the thickness of your fish fillets, adjust the cooking time for perfect tenderness.

Recipe Variation

Get creative with Masala Baked Fish! Here are a few variations to try:

  1. Masala Baked Shrimp: Substitute fish fillets with shrimp for a delicious seafood twist. Adjust marinating time to about 10 minutes to avoid overcooking.
  2. Curry-Style Fish: Incorporate coconut milk into the marinade for a creamier texture and additional flavor. This variation pairs well with white fish like cod or halibut.
  3. Vegetarian Option: Replace fish with marinated tofu or paneer for a vegetarian-friendly dish that still celebrates masala flavors.
  4. Oven-Baked Whole Fish: If you’re feeling adventurous, try baking a whole fish, such as snapper or trout, marinated in the same spices for a stunning presentation.

Freezing and Storage

  • Storage: Keep le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2-3 days to retain freshness.
  • Freezing: You can freeze marinated fish fillets for up to 3 months. Ensure they are well-covered to avoid freezer burn. When ready to cook, thaw in the refrigerator overnight before baking.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use frozen fish for this recipe?

Yes, but make sure to thaw it completely and pat it dry before marinating. This will help the flavors absorb better.

What fish works best for this recipe?

White fish like cod or tilapia is ideal, but salmon works beautifully too for those who enjoy a rich flavor.

Can I adjust the spices to make it milder?

Absolutely! Feel free to decrease the chili powder or omit it entirely if you prefer a milder dish.

How do I know when the fish is fully cooked?

The fish should flake easily with a fork, and the flesh should appear opaque.
